Analyses of quiet technology seasonal relief incentives for Grand Canyon National Park: Combined annual reports for 2015–2018

This report describes the legislative background, modeling process, and annual results used by the National Park Service (NPS) and the Federal Aviation Administration (FAA) in order to meet the requirements of the National Parks Overflights Act of 1987 (Public Law 100-91), the National Parks Air Tour Management Act of 2000 (NPATMA, Public Law 106-181) and the Moving Ahead for Progress in the 21st Century Act of 2012 (MAP-21, Public Law 112-141) regarding the substantial restoration of natural quiet at Grand Canyon National Park. MAP-21 requires all commercial air tour aircraft operating within the Grand Canyon National Park Special Flight Rules Area convert to quiet aircraft technology (QT) within 15 years (i.e., by 2027). MAP-21 also requires the FAA and NPS to provide incentives for commercial air tour operators that convert to QT prior to the statutory mandate. Pursuant to NPATMA, the cumulative impact of providing incentives, such as increasing flight allocations for QT, must not increase noise at Grand Canyon and must not diminish the achievement of substantial restoration of natural quiet that was called for in the Overflights Act. On January 1, 2015, the agencies implemented a QT incentive for commercial air tour operators consistent with both MAP-21 and NPATMA. The incentive provides seasonal relief during the first quarter (January–March) from allocations for commercial air tour operators that utilized QT aircraft in the popular Dragon and Zuni Point corridors. During the first quarter, QT air tours did not need to use an allocation, while non-quiet technology air tours still required the use of an allocation. The allocations that operators would have been required to use during the first quarter (“saved” allocations) can then be flown within the corridors during other times of the year. The NPS and FAA developed a methodology to ensure the incentive complies with the statutory mandates for not increasing noise at Grand Canyon and not diminishing the achievement of substantial restoration of natural quiet. Beginning in 2015, the agencies have modeled each year’s commercial tours flown in the Dragon and Zuni Point corridors. This report summarizes the annual air tour reporting data, use of QT, and results of the modeling for cumulative noise and substantial restoration of natural quiet for years 2015–2018. Key results include: ● Quiet technology incentives appear to increase QT usage during the seasonal relief period—the first quarter of the year. Quiet technology usage is greatest in the first quarter, averaging 86%, and then drops in the second through fourth quarters. Quiet technology usage is lowest in the third quarter when total flights are highest. ● Modeled annual noise exposure through 2018 has not exceeded the 2012 baseline level. However, the annual noise exposure has closely approached the baseline level. The substantial restoration of natural quiet has not been diminished. The area of the park free of noise for 75% of the day has not dropped below 50%. During days of peak activity, the percentage of park area free of noise for 75% of the day has ranged from 62–67%. The NPS and FAA will continue annual evaluation of seasonal relief incentives through modeling of annual noise exposure in the Dragon and Zuni Point corridors, as well as the achievement of substantial restoration of natural quiet through modeling of audibility duration throughout the park.
